💸 Why Choosing the Right First Car Matters

Many new players make a common mistake: spending all their money on a flashy but expensive and impractical vehicle. In GTA 5 RP, it’s important to consider not only appearance but also factors such as:

  • Price — the car should be affordable even after just a few hours of gameplay.
  • Trunk capacity — determines how many items you can carry, especially early in the game.
  • Fuel efficiency — the less you spend on gas, the more money you save for progression.
  • Tuning potential — the ability to visually and technically upgrade your vehicle over time.

🚗 Top Cars for Beginners on Grand RolePlay

1. Beater Tornado

The cheapest and one of the most versatile options. Despite its rusty appearance, this car has a turbo option and a 12-slot trunk. A great choice for your first few hours on the server.

2. Glendale

A classic that looks like a car your dad might give you after graduation. Priced around $28,000, it features a spacious trunk and excellent fuel economy. Ideal for those who want both style and practicality.

3. Brioso R8

A small, agile car priced at $47,000. It offers excellent handling and compact design. Its 12-slot trunk provides the perfect balance of convenience and functionality.

4. Zion Classic

A retro-style car focused on elegance. Its fuel efficiency makes it ideal for long trips, and the $50,000 price tag keeps it affordable for most players.

5. Asea

A modern sedan priced at $62,000, combining comfort, reliability, and space. It boasts low fuel consumption and a wide range of customization options. Perfect for players who have some experience but still want to spend wisely.

🛠 How Tuning Helps Beginners

Tuning isn’t just about looks. Proper upgrades can:

  • Improve speed and handling.
  • Change the appearance to stand out from other players.
  • Increase resale value.

Even budget cars like the Tornado or Glendale can become unique and stylish vehicles with the right modifications.
